Balsamic Summer Pasta

As the summer months are slowly coming upon us we start looking for lighter recipes and the other night we made two great dishes centered around balsamic. These recipes were a couple of make up as you go dishes with what we had laying around the kitchen, let me do my best to explain to you how you can make these dishes for yourself. Pasta:


-Finley chop half a white onion 
-Cut about a 2 cups of cherry tomatoes into halves
-Mince about four cloves of garlic


-Place all the chopped items in a sauce pan on medium heat
-Add a half a cup of olive oil to the sauce pan 
-Add a quarter cup of balsamic to the sauce pan 
-Let all the items caramelize in the sauce pan

-While the items in the sauce pan are caramelizing starting cooking whole wheat spaghetti noodles in a large pot 


-When the noodles have finished drain, place in bowl and top with contents of sauce pan
-Add some fresh mozzarella balls to the top  
-Top with fresh Parmesan and serve 



Salad:

Fill salad bowl with:
-Spinach
-Granny Smith Apples
-Pine nuts
-Goat cheese
-Top it all off with Balsamic dressing
-Toss and serve
